Welcome to this week’s featured ink review! Today, we’re diving into Dominant Industry Apple Blossom ink from their Pearl Ink Series. If you’ve been searching for a shimmering ink with a bold red hue that veers toward hot pink, read on to find out if this ink belongs in your collection.
Meet the Ink Maker: Dominant Industry
Dominant Industry, a South Korean brand, is celebrated for creating high-quality, innovative fountain pen inks. Known for their vivid colors and unique formulations, their Pearl Ink Series showcases a stunning combination of shimmering effects and dynamic hues.

This Week’s Featured Ink: Apple Blossom

Apple Blossom is a vibrant red ink that leans toward hot pink, enhanced with a silver shimmer that is noticeable even in regular writing. Ink Bottle and Packaging

Dominant Industry Apple Blossom ink comes in beautifully designed, sturdy packaging:
- Outer Packaging: Brown, protective box.
- Ink Bottle: A 25ml glass bottle shaped like a droplet.
- Extras: Enclosed in a drawstring duster bag, with a dropper included for easy use.
The packaging is premium and practical, ensuring the ink stays secure while offering a delightful unboxing experience.
Dominant Industry Apple Blossom Ink Review: 1-Dip Test

Using the J. Herbin Glass Dip Pen, we were able to write three full lines on Rhodia paper with plenty of ink still left on the nib. Excellent performance!
How Fast Did Apple Blossom Ink Dry?

During our review Dominant Industry Apple Blossom ink showed a dry time of about 20 seconds.
How Did Apple Blossom Ink Respond to Water?
We put Apple Blossom fountain pen ink to our standard water test (even though we are fully aware this is not a water proof ink). We just think it’s a good idea to know how much it hates being exposed to moisture…or not. Here’s how it responded.

- Significant running of the ink
- Visible line distortion
- Fading of ink lines was prevalent
- Visible feathering of the ink visible
- Still no bleed through on the paper
All in all, Dominant Industry Apple Blossom ink doesn’t hold up well to water. Don’t journal in the rain with this one.
Did the Ink Bleed Through During the Review?

We saw no ink bleed through while we were using the Apple Blossom ink on Rhodia paper.
Was There Any Feathering During the Apple Blossom Ink Review?
We saw no feathering of the ink during the review either (still using Rhodia paper).
Apple Blossom Ink Review: Any Shading Properties?

Dominant Industry Apple Blossom ink showed some shading traits. It definitely leans towards a magenta rather than burgundy in everyday uses – I like that it writes in a deeper shade of magenta-pink than you may at first expect. It looked almost pink after the water test, but that’s a trait that would only show up in very specific applications.
Is this a Shimmering or Glistening Ink?

Dominant Industry Apple Blossom ink is definitely a shimmer ink; although Dominant Industry refers to the shimmer or glistening inks as Pearl inks. The silvery shimmer is very apparent during the cotton swab tests, but you can also see it during regular use.
Final Conclusion: Apple Blossom Ink Review

After working with today’s ink, I can say that it’s a lovely red-pink ink with plenty of shimmer. It’s packaged very well and comes in a high-quality ink bottle/bag. It doesn’t hold up well to water (but exposure to water does generate an interesting pinkish/magenta variation rather than the deep magenta-red pink you see in writing or swatching). During normal use, it’s a great everyday shimmery RED-pink ink that’s easy to use and easy to see on the page.
